Material Composition and Surface Finish
Our Flow-Control Valves are crafted from 316L stainless steel, which provides exceptional corrosion resistance and durability. We adhere strictly to ASME BPE 2019 and 3-A Sanitary Standard 2022, ensuring that every valve meets the highest industry standards. The surface finish is electropolished to a 15Ra or better, minimizing bacterial adhesion and simplifying CIP/SIP processes. This level of finish is crucial for maintaining sterility and reducing the risk of contamination.

Cleanability and Maintenance
Cleanability is another major concern. Our valves are engineered for easy cleaning and maintenance. The design minimizes dead legs and ensures >99.9% recovery during cleaning cycles. This reduces the risk of product carryover and contamination. Additionally, the valves are equipped with quick-release fittings, making it easy to replace components without extensive downtime. This is particularly important in high-purity environments where cleanliness is paramount.
